Riverside Charitable Corporation

Riverside Charitable Corporation reported paying Recinda Kay Shafer, Deputy Executive Director, $512,400 in total compensation (FY 2024).

That places Recinda Kay Shafer at approximately the 94th percentile among 210 similarly sized housing & shelter nonprofits (median $247,279).
